Synonyms for Fever. 958 other terms for fever- words and phrases with similar … WebFeb 9, 2024 · Other common symptoms along with the fever include a skin rash, severe headache, pain behind the eyes, in the muscles and joints. For many affected individuals, the disease is self-limited, ending with full recovery after symptoms resolve in 5-7 days. Up to 5% of all dengue affected individuals develop severe, life-threatening disease. pumpkin donuts

The word, pyrexia, derives its origin from the Greek root, pyros, which means “fire” or “burning heat”. It is simply the medical term for fever.
